A Chill Pill for Your Curiosity
Unfortunately, the Houston Zoo is more of a tropical paradise than an Arctic tundra. No penguins, no walruses, and most importantly, no polar bears. It's like trying to find a snowball in July – just not gonna happen.
You might be wondering, "Why no polar bears in Houston?" Well, picture a polar bear sweating buckets in the Texas heat. Not a pretty sight, is it? Polar bears are adapted to freezing temperatures and have a thick coat of fur to keep them warm. Houston, on the other hand, is known for its scorching summers and humidity levels that could make a swamp jealous.
